我正在使用C#程序下载一个zip文件,但出现错误atSystem.IO.Compression.ZipArchive.ReadEndOfCentralDirectory()atSystem.IO.Compression.ZipArchive.Init(Streamstream,ZipArchiveModemode,BooleanleaveOpen)atSystem.IO.Compression.ZipArchive..ctor(Streamstream,ZipArchiveModemode,BooleanleaveOpen,EncodingentryNameEncoding)atSys
我正在使用C#程序下载一个zip文件,但出现错误atSystem.IO.Compression.ZipArchive.ReadEndOfCentralDirectory()atSystem.IO.Compression.ZipArchive.Init(Streamstream,ZipArchiveModemode,BooleanleaveOpen)atSystem.IO.Compression.ZipArchive..ctor(Streamstream,ZipArchiveModemode,BooleanleaveOpen,EncodingentryNameEncoding)atSys
如何删除回车符(\r)和字符串末尾的Unix换行符(\n)? 最佳答案 这将从s末尾剪掉任何回车符和换行符的组合:s=s.TrimEnd(newchar[]{'\r','\n'});编辑:或者正如JP善意指出的那样,您可以更简洁地拼写为:s=s.TrimEnd('\r','\n'); 关于c#-从C#中的字符串末尾删除回车符和换行符,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/
如何删除回车符(\r)和字符串末尾的Unix换行符(\n)? 最佳答案 这将从s末尾剪掉任何回车符和换行符的组合:s=s.TrimEnd(newchar[]{'\r','\n'});编辑:或者正如JP善意指出的那样,您可以更简洁地拼写为:s=s.TrimEnd('\r','\n'); 关于c#-从C#中的字符串末尾删除回车符和换行符,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/
现代浏览器和Node.js等环境允许您说{a:1,b:2,}或[1,2,3,]。这在历史上一直是InternetExplorer的问题。这在InternetExplorer9中已修复吗? 最佳答案 对此有两种不同的答案,一种针对对象初始值设定项中的悬挂逗号,另一种针对数组初始值设定项中的悬挂逗号:对于对象初始化器,例如:varobj={a:1,b:2,c:3,};它已在IE8及更高版本中修复。在这里测试:http://jsbin.com/UXuHopeC/1(source)。IE7及更早版本将在}上抛出语法错误在逗号之后。对于数组初
现代浏览器和Node.js等环境允许您说{a:1,b:2,}或[1,2,3,]。这在历史上一直是InternetExplorer的问题。这在InternetExplorer9中已修复吗? 最佳答案 对此有两种不同的答案,一种针对对象初始值设定项中的悬挂逗号,另一种针对数组初始值设定项中的悬挂逗号:对于对象初始化器,例如:varobj={a:1,b:2,c:3,};它已在IE8及更高版本中修复。在这里测试:http://jsbin.com/UXuHopeC/1(source)。IE7及更早版本将在}上抛出语法错误在逗号之后。对于数组初
我正在使用正则表达式从javascript(在IE中运行)的文本输入区域中去除无效字符。我在每个keyup事件上运行替换函数。但是,这会使光标在每次按键后跳到文本框的末尾,从而无法进行内联编辑。这是实际操作:http://jsbin.com/ifufuv/2有谁知道如何让光标不跳到输入框的末尾吗? 最佳答案 除了gilly3'sanswer,我认为有人可能会发现查看实际代码片段很有用。在下面的示例中,selectionStart属性是在JavaScript字符串操作之前从input元素中检索的。然后selectionStart设置回
我正在使用正则表达式从javascript(在IE中运行)的文本输入区域中去除无效字符。我在每个keyup事件上运行替换函数。但是,这会使光标在每次按键后跳到文本框的末尾,从而无法进行内联编辑。这是实际操作:http://jsbin.com/ifufuv/2有谁知道如何让光标不跳到输入框的末尾吗? 最佳答案 除了gilly3'sanswer,我认为有人可能会发现查看实际代码片段很有用。在下面的示例中,selectionStart属性是在JavaScript字符串操作之前从input元素中检索的。然后selectionStart设置回
这个问题已经以几种不同的形式被问到,但我无法得到任何适合我的场景的答案。当用户点击向上/向下箭头时,我正在使用jQuery来实现命令历史记录。当按下向上箭头时,我用上一个命令替换输入值并将焦点设置在输入字段上,但希望光标始终位于输入字符串的末尾。我的代码,原样:$(document).keydown(function(e){varkey=e.charCode?e.charCode:e.keyCode?e.keyCode:0;varinput=self.shell.find('input.current:last');switch(key){case38://uplastQuery=se
这个问题已经以几种不同的形式被问到,但我无法得到任何适合我的场景的答案。当用户点击向上/向下箭头时,我正在使用jQuery来实现命令历史记录。当按下向上箭头时,我用上一个命令替换输入值并将焦点设置在输入字段上,但希望光标始终位于输入字符串的末尾。我的代码,原样:$(document).keydown(function(e){varkey=e.charCode?e.charCode:e.keyCode?e.keyCode:0;varinput=self.shell.find('input.current:last');switch(key){case38://uplastQuery=se